Abstract

A system and method for shattering a launch vehicle into relatively small pieces are described. The launch vehicle includes at least one solid fuel rocket motor having a propellant disposed about a combustion chamber within a rocket motor case. Each rocket motor also includes at least one motor igniter to ignite the propellant and at least one explosive charge adjacent the rocket motor case. A firing unit is capable of generating a motor ignition signal and a charge explosion signal. A first propagator carries the motor ignition signal to the motor igniter so the signal arrives after a propagation time T.sub.ignition and causes ignition of the previously unignited rocket motor. A second propagator carries the charge explosion signal to the explosive charge so the signal arrives after a propagation time T.sub.explosion and causes an explosion against the rocket motor case. The time T.sub.explosion is greater than the time T.sub.ignition by a pressurization time T.sub.pressurization that is sufficient to allow pressurization of the combustion chamber before actuation of the explosive charge.
